Address

ecash:pz40rjayyehv8ulu0ke966cq0nddr5u35vnw7tuz2wCopy

Total Received

12241.43 XEC

Total Sent

12235.96 XEC

№ Transactions

9

Final Balance

5.47 XEC

Transactions
Filter